Navigate to /System/Library/Extensions/ and move any existing AppleIntelGMA KEXTs to a backup folder on your desktop to prevent conflicts.
Warning: Installing macOS on non-Apple hardware may violate Apple’s macOS license agreement and can be technically complex. Proceed at your own risk. This guide is for educational purposes only.
Handles GPU-accelerated window compositing.
GraphicsEnabler Yes IntelCapriFB 10 Use code with caution. Post-Installation and Troubleshooting
:
The success of any Hackintosh project relies heavily on the tools developed by the community:
The 3DMark06 scores for the GMA 3150 placed it slightly below the GMA 950 but above the GMA 3100. It was never designed for gaming or intensive graphical workflows. Instead, its purpose was to provide a basic graphical interface for the ultra-mobile, battery-efficient computers of its era. The growing inability to handle even standard-definition Flash video smoothly at 480p, and the severe struggles at 720p and above, highlighted its fundamental lack of power. This hardware foundation was the primary obstacle that any Hackintosh driver project had to face from the outset.
The UI will feel sluggish, and apps like iMovie or Maps won't work.
Download the package suitable for your macOS version. Open Kext Wizard . Navigate to the "Installation" tab. Mod Driver Gma 3150 Hackintosh Zone
Finder menu bars and docks remain solid gray due to lack of QE/CI.
The is a legacy integrated graphics solution found in Atom-based netbooks like the Lenovo S10-3s and HP Mini. While macOS was never natively designed for this hardware, the Hackintosh community, particularly via platforms like Hackintosh Zone and InsanelyMac , has developed mod drivers to enable basic functionality. Compatibility and Core Limitations
Here is a comprehensive technical breakdown of how the GMA 3150 mod driver operates, its limitations, and the step-by-step process required to implement it on legacy macOS installations. The Core Challenge: GMA 3150 and macOS Architecture
Boot using the flags -x (Safe Mode) or -f (Ignore Cache). This bypasses the modded driver, allowing you to get back into the OS to delete the kext or fix the ID strings. Issue: Resolution Changed, but Screen Flashes or Glitches This guide is for educational purposes only
In the "Zone" era, the tool NetbookInstaller (NBI) or later NetbookBootMaker was the gold standard for GMA 3150.
Drag your modded AppleIntelGMA950.kext and AppleIntelGMA950FB.kext files into the tool interface.
However, you can still get a functional display and native resolution using specific community "mods" and legacy drivers. The Reality of Maximum OS Support: You are generally limited to Snow Leopard (10.6) Lion (10.7) The Big Catch: no full hardware acceleration (QE/CI)
Best for thread starters, sharing custom kexts, or asking the community for troubleshooting help. Post-Installation and Troubleshooting : The success of any
For macOS to recognize and communicate with any piece of hardware (including a GPU), it requires a specific . Since Apple never produced a Mac with a GMA 3150, it never wrote an official driver for it. This is where the concept of a "Mod Driver" comes into play.